“…Another influential feature is the low quantization levels that make these modulators attractive for signal processing. As an example, other recent publications show important benefits for ultra wide-band communications with single-bit CT encoded streams [2]. The main reason is that a single-bit architecture allows using, in the feedback loop, a simple comparator and a digital buffer as Digital-to-Analog converter (DAC) and ADC, respectively, thus reducing the delay in the loop.…”

“…In particular, the binary quantizers including delta modulators ( -Ms) and delta sigma modulators ( -Ms) are widely utilized in power conversions for their implementation simplicity [ 3 , 4 ], networked and quantized control systems for their low-data rate [ 5 , 6 ], and as typical complex systems for their high nonlinearity, periodicity and robustness at the same time [ 7 , 8 ]. Such systems are often used as coding mechanism in many applications such bio-medical engineering (see [ 9 , 10 ]) due to their low energy consumption and ability in data compression and for reducing the wiring in communication systems where the communication channels are shared by many entities and hardware resources are limited [ 11 , 12 ].…”
